Chinese Ion Beam Equipment Maker Boton Optoelectronics Secures Over $14 Million in Series B+ Funding
Boton Optoelectronics, a Chinese company specializing in ion beam equipment, has successfully closed a Series B+ funding round, raising over 100 million RMB (approximately $14 million USD). The investment was led by Yida Capital, CITIC Jian Investment, Dawu Ventures, and others, with IO Capital serving as the exclusive financial advisor. The newly acquired capital will be allocated to recruiting top talent, developing new products, and accelerating investments in integrated solutions, market expansion, and production capacity for high-growth sectors.
Founded in 2016 and recognized as a national "specialized, refined, unique, and new" enterprise, Boton Optoelectronics is a leader in domestically produced ion sources and precision ion beam equipment. The company uniquely possesses end-to-end core technologies, from ion sources and complete equipment to application processes, all developed in-house. While precision optics, semiconductors, and aerospace provide a stable revenue base, Boton has become a critical supplier for emerging fields like controlled nuclear fusion, optical communications, and quantum technology, achieving over 50% year-on-year revenue growth.
In controlled nuclear fusion, Boton holds a near-monopolistic market share, being the sole domestic supplier of ion sources and complete equipment for the ion beam-assisted deposition (IBAD) process essential for second-generation high-temperature superconducting tapes. For the booming optical communications sector, driven by AI's demand for computing power, Boton's IBS/IBD technology offers advantages in low loss and high precision for components like laser chips and modulators, while its IBE/RIBE capabilities are crucial for etching new materials like lithium niobate. In quantum technology, Boton is a key player, having secured national projects for quantum computing, detection, and communication, leveraging its ion beam technology for ultra-high precision optical devices.
